Yes: g/kg/sec = g kg-1 s-1

On 7/24/13 10:51 AM, Guilherme Martins wrote:
> Thanks,
>
> Now it's ok.
>
> The unit is *[g kg-1 s-1]*?
>
> *According to:*
>
> u = f->uvel(0,0,:,:) ; m/s
> v = f->vvel(0,0,:,:) ; m/s
> q = f->umes(0,0,:,:) ; kg/kg
> *uq = u*(q*1e3) ; kg/kg -> g/kg*
> *vq = v*(q*1e3) ; kg/kg -> g/kg*
>
> dv = uv2dvG(uq,vq) ; divergence - gaussian grid
> dv@long_name = "moisture divergence"
>
>
> Guilherme
>
>
> 2013/7/24 Dennis Shea <shea@ucar.edu>
>
>> I think what you want is
>>
>> uq = u*q
>> vq = v*q
>> dv = uv2dvG(uq,vq)
>> dv@long_name = "moisture divergence"
